The Holiday Spirit

The Atlanta History Center's “The Holiday Spirit” takes visitors back in time, Dickens’ style. Guests are greeted by a friendly holiday spirit from Christmas present at the Smith Family Farm and Swan House. Through this immersive experience, visitors explore the changing meaning of the holiday season and discover how Atlantans celebrated holidays during the 1860s and 1930s. Learn how some of the traditions were established and leave with a reminder of the true meaning of the holiday spirit and how the bonds of family and community can provide the strength to survive changing times.

In addition, visitors enjoy other holiday activities including musical performances, Smith Family Farm demonstrations and hands-on activities, candlelit trails, and kid-friendly crafts.

The Holiday Spirit is free for members and included with general admission for non-members. Food available for purchase. Guided tour bookings will be taken at admissions on evening of programs only; tours run approximately every 10 minutes and last approximately 60 minutes.
